Kodi crahes on Autostart
#1
Hi everybody,

for some reasons Kodi crahes if i put it in Autostart. I suggest it happend after i installed veracrypt and made:
apt --fix-broken install:
Because some libraries are missing. Its only a suggestion possibly it has nothing to do with veracrypt.

I installed the system new because i had that mistake earlier but now i am at the same point like before.
My System ist:
Kernel: 6.2.0-37-generic x86_64 bits: 64 Desktop: KDE Plasma 5.27.9 Distro: KDE neon 22.04 5.27:

Here is some of the kodi_crashlog:

############## Kodi CRASH LOG ############### ################ SYSTEM INFO ################ Date: So 3. Dez 18:24:19 CET 2023 Kodi Options: Arch: x86_64 Kernel: Linux 6.2.0-37-generic #38~22.04.1-Ubuntu SMP PREEMPT_DYNAMIC Thu Nov 2 18:01:13 UTC 2 Release: KDE neon 5.27 ############## END SYSTEM INFO ############## ############### STACK TRACE ################# =====> Core file: /home/hondo/core.3065 (2023-12-03 18:23:33.474180226 +0100) ========================================= This GDB supports auto-downloading debuginfo from the following URLs: https://debuginfod.neon.kde.org/: Enable debuginfod for this session? (y or [n:
) [answered N; input not from terminal] Debuginfod has been disabled. To make this setting permanent, add 'set debuginfod enabled off' to .gdbinit. [New LWP 3090] [New LWP 3066] [New LWP 3065] [New LWP 3069] [New LWP 3074] [New LWP 3080] [New LWP 3081] [New LWP 3073] [New LWP 3084] [New LWP 3082] [New LWP 3086] [New LWP 3083] [New LWP 3089] [New LWP 3092] [New LWP 3094] [New LWP 3093] [New LWP 3085] [New LWP 3102] [New LWP 3099] [New LWP 3103] [New LWP 15592] [New LWP 3091] [New LWP 3101] [New LWP 15429] Core was generated by `/usr/lib/x86_64-linux-gnu/kodi/kodi.bin'. Program terminated with signal SIGSEGV, Segmentation fault. #0 0x00005635e80849c3 in EVENTSERVER::CEventServer::Cleanup() () [Current thread is 1 (LWP 3090)] Thread 24 (LWP 15429): warning: Section `.reg-xstate/15429' in core file too small. #0 __futex_abstimed_wait_common64 (private=0, cancel=true, abstime=0x7f1dd77fd380, op=137, expected=0, futex_word=0x5635eb91d448) at ./nptl/futex-internal.c:57 #1 __futex_abstimed_wait_common (cancel=true, private=0, abstime=0x7f1dd77fd380, clockid=0, expected=0, futex_word=0x5635eb91d448) at ./nptl/futex-internal.c:87 #2 __GI___futex_abstimed_wait_cancelable64 (futex_word=futex_word@entry=0x5635eb91d448, expected=expected@entry=0, clockid=clockid@entry=1, abstime=abstime@entry=0x7f1dd77fd380, private=private@entry=0) at ./nptl/futex-internal.c:139 #3 0x00007f1e242942dd in __pthread_cond_wait_common (abstime=0x7f1dd77fd380, clockid=1, mutex=0x5635ebaa4960, cond=0x5635eb91d420) at ./nptl/pthread_cond_wait.c:503 #4 ___pthread_cond_clockwait64 (abstime=0x7f1dd77fd380, clockid=1, mutex=0x5635ebaa4960, cond=0x5635eb91d420) at ./nptl/pthread_cond_wait.c:691 #5 ___pthread_cond_clockwait64 (cond=0x5635eb91d420, mutex=0x5635ebaa4960, clockid=1, abstime=0x7f1dd77fd380) at ./nptl/pthread_cond_wait.c:679 #6 0x00005635e7897be1 in CJobManager::GetNextJob() () #7 0x00005635e7898b57 in CJobWorker:Tonguerocess() () #8 0x00005635e7939635 in CThread::Action() () #9 0x00005635e793a24b in () #10 0x00005635e793ad7d in () #11 0x00007f1e23cdc253 in () at /lib/x86_64-linux-gnu/libstdc++.so.6 #12 0x00007f1e24294ac3 in start_thread (arg= ) at ./nptl/pthread_create.c:442 #13 0x00007f1e24326a40 in clone3 () at ../sysdeps/unix/sysv/linux/x86_64/clone3.S:81 Thread 23 (LWP 3101): warning: Section `.reg-xstate/3101' in core file too small. #0 __futex_abstimed_wait_common64 (private=0, cancel=true, abstime=0x7f1d957343f0, op=137, expected=0, futex_word=0x5635eb9ec230) at ./nptl/futex-internal.c:57 #1 __futex_abstimed_wait_common (cancel=true, private=0, abstime=0x7f1d957343f0, clockid=0, expected=0, futex_word=0x5635eb9ec230) at ./nptl/futex-internal.c:87 #2 __GI___futex_abstimed_wait_cancelable64 (futex_word=futex_word@entry=0x5635eb9ec230, expected=expected@entry=0, clockid=clockid@entry=1, abstime=abstime@entry=0x7f1d957343f0, private=private@entry=0) at ./nptl/futex-internal.c:139 #3 0x00007f1e242942dd in __pthread_cond_wait_common (abstime=0x7f1d957343f0, clockid=1, mutex=0x5635eb96f0c0, cond=0x5635eb9ec208) at ./nptl/pthread_cond_wait.c:503 #4 ___pthread_cond_clockwait64 (abstime=0x7f1d957343f0, clockid=1, mutex=0x5635eb96f0c0, cond=0x5635eb9ec208) at ./nptl/pthread_cond_wait.c:691 #5 ___pthread_cond_clockwait64 (cond=0x5635eb9ec208, mutex=0x5635eb96f0c0, clockid=1, abstime=0x7f1d957343f0) at ./nptl/pthread_cond_wait.c:679 #6 0x00005635e7ee3b46 in PVR::CPVRGUIInfo:Tonguerocess() () #7 0x00005635e7939635 in CThread::Action() () #8 0x00005635e793a24b in () #9 0x00005635e793ad7d in () #10 0x00007f1e23cdc253 in () at /lib/x86_64-linux-gnu/libstdc++.so.6 #11 0x00007f1e24294ac3 in start_thread (arg= ) at ./nptl/pthread_create.c:442 #12 0x00007f1e24326a40 in clone3 () at ../sysdeps/unix/sysv/linux/x86_64/clone3.S:81 Thread 22 (LWP 3091): warning: Section `.reg-xstate/3091' in core file too small. #0 __futex_abstimed_wait_common64 (private=-402866526, cancel=true, abstime=0x7f1db8ff8500, op=137, expected=0, futex_word=0x7f1dc40402b8) at ./nptl/futex-internal.c:57 #1 __futex_abstimed_wait_common (cancel=true, private=-402866526, abstime=0x7f1db8ff8500, clockid=0, expected=0, futex_word=0x7f1dc40402b8) at ./nptl/futex-internal.c:87 #2 __GI___futex_abstimed_wait_cancelable64 (futex_word=futex_word@entry=0x7f1dc40402b8, expected=expected@entry=0, clockid=clockid@entry=1, abstime=abstime@entry=0x7f1db8ff8500, private=private@entry=0) at ./nptl/futex-internal.c:139 #3 0x00007f1e242942dd in __pthread_cond_wait_common (abstime=0x7f1db8ff8500, clockid=1, mutex=0x7f1dc4040260, cond=0x7f1dc4040290) at ./nptl/pthread_cond_wait.c:503 #4 ___pthread_cond_clockwait64 (abstime=0x7f1db8ff8500, clockid=1, mutex=0x7f1dc4040260, cond=0x7f1dc4040290) at ./nptl/pthread_cond_wait.c:691 #5 ___pthread_cond_clockwait64 (cond=0x7f1dc4040290, mutex=0x7f1dc4040260, clockid=1, abstime=0x7f1db8ff8500) at ./nptl/pthread_cond_wait.c:679 #6 0x00007f1df7165347 in () at /usr/lib/x86_64-linux-gnu/kodi/addons/pvr.hts/pvr.hts.so.20.6.5 #7 0x00007f1df719594b in () at /usr/lib/x86_64-linux-gnu/kodi/addons/pvr.hts/pvr.hts.so.20.6.5 #8 0x00007f1df716870e in () at /usr/lib/x86_64-linux-gnu/kodi/addons/pvr.hts/pvr.hts.so.20.6.5 #9 0x00007f1e23cdc253 in () at /lib/x86_64-linux-gnu/libstdc++.so.6 #10 0x00007f1e24294ac3 in start_thread (arg= ) at ./nptl/pthread_create.c:442 #11 0x00007f1e24326a40 in clone3 () at ../sysdeps/unix/sysv/linux/x86_64/clone3.S:81]

Is there somebody who can explain me the mistake or better solve it?

Greetings

Hondo
Reply
#2
To receive meaningful assistance you will need to provide a full debug log.

The instructions are here... Debug Log

If you are using the Basic Method, then ensure the following is applied...
1.Enable debugging in Settings>System Settings>Logging,
2.Restart Kodi
3.Replicate the problem.
4.Upload the log to Kodi Paste Site manually or use the Kodi Logfile Uploader. (wiki) With either method post the link to the log back here.

If you are using the Advanced Method ensure you have correctly created and applied the advancedsettings.xml file (wiki)

In both instances, you should see the word DEBUG throughout the log.

Note: Full logs only. No partial or redacted logs
Do NOT post your logs directly into the forum. Use the Kodi Paste Site. Post the link to your pasted log in the forum
Reply
#3
Also please use our paste site for logs, don't paste them directly into posts.

Copy/paste and save them there, and provide the URL you will be given instead as a link to what you've uploaded.
|Banned add-ons (wiki)|Forum rules (wiki)|VPN policy (wiki)|First time user (wiki)|FAQs (wiki) Troubleshooting (wiki)|Add-ons (wiki)|Free content (wiki)|Debug Log (wiki)|

Kodi Blog Posts
Reply
#4
Ok i have done it, on the first start it crashes again, here is the Link to the log from /.kodi/temp/

https://paste.kodi.tv/oxakuhomif.kodi

I hope somebody can help me to fix this problem.


Greetings
Hondo
Reply
#5
crash appears to originate with pvr.hts i would recommend removing it for testing and see if the behavior changes
it would also not be a bad idea to start with a clean slate by moving the kodi data folder in home, mv ~/.kodi ~/.kodi.old
Reply
#6
thx a lot for the response!!!
I will try it, and give u and answer. In case of pvr makes the trouble i need it to connect kodi with the tvheadend backend. So maybe there is an alternative solution if pvr makes the trouble.

LG
Hondo
Reply
#7
since you do need it, IF it is actually that addon to blame (i.e. it does not crash when removed) then you should follow up with an issue report on github or in the PVR section of the forum to further diagnose issues with that addon

https://github.com/kodi-pvr/pvr.hts/issues

https://forum.kodi.tv/forumdisplay.php?fid=168
Reply
#8
dear izprtxqkft,

it was not the pvr-hts-addon! I started the computer again with deinstalled pvr-hts-addon (made before reboot sudo apt remove --purge  kodi-pvr-tvheadend-hts
). After restart and kodi in autostart, kodi crashes again.
I have an actual kodi_crashlog-20231206_190704.log. I pasted it to :
https://paste.kodi.tv/uxifuyawif.kodi

Maybe u can help me with another solution.


Greetings

hondo
Reply

Logout Mark Read Team Forum Stats Members Help
Kodi crahes on Autostart0